1. The Federation Credentials Verification Service (FCVS)
The FCVS acts as a central digital repository for a physician's core qualifications. Once a medical professional publishes their medical school transcripts, test scores (USMLE/COMLEX), and postgraduate training records, Schnelle Medizinische Approbation Online the FCVS verifies them at the source. Once validated, these digital credentials can be sent out to any state board with the click of a button, getting rid of the requirement to retake these steps for every brand-new license.
2. The Interstate Medical Licensure Compact (IMLC)
The IMLC is perhaps the most significant improvement in digital licensing. It is an agreement between participating U.S. states to considerably improve the licensing procedure for doctors who want to practice in several states.

The surge in digital licensing is largely driven by the explosion of telehealth. To legally deal with a patient in a various state, a doctor should be accredited in the state where the patient is located. Digital websites permit telehealth companies to onboard physicians rapidly, ensuring that they can scale their services across state lines without being bogged down by bureaucratic delays.

Without the ability to acquire licenses digitally, the fast reaction needed during public health crises or the expansion of rural healthcare gain access to would be almost impossible.

2. For how long does the digital licensing procedure take?
Through the Interstate Medical Licensure Compact (IMLC), a license can sometimes be released in as little as 2 to 3 weeks. Requirement digital applications through state websites normally take between 60 and 90 days, depending on the state's particular verification requirements.
3. Can International Medical Graduates (IMGs) use digital websites?
Yes, IMGs can utilize the FCVS to digitize and validate their credentials. However, they need to also offer ECFMG certification, which is also processed and transmitted digitally to state boards.
4. Do I have to spend for a brand-new license every year?
Renewal cycles differ by state; most require renewal each to 2 years. The renewal procedure is nearly entirely digital in all 50 states, requiring the payment of a charge and proof of finished Continuing Medical Education (CME).
